I agree with all of faline's facts ... I'm mostly here to comment on #2.

If you want your guys to have something personalized and special, then that's a great reason to get a car service. Like you, I'm a big DME fan and two-time very satisfied customer, but if you want that "special" personalized experience then it sounds like the car service is the right thing for you.

On a round-trip, the tip is usually 10% of the total to each driver. I would go a little higher on a one-way trip. For example, if my charge was $60, I'd give at least a $10 bill rather than giving $6. I'd be happy to give more than $10 if there service was above and beyond, and I'd certainly give less than $10 for really cruddy service. But I just threw out a figure because you asked for one.

Yes, you can do DME just one-way, in either direction. If you want, you can wait until you are at WDW, and make your homeward-bound DME reservation at your resort a few days before your vacation is done. But if you like to have everything sewn up before then, go ahead and make the DME reservation through Disney or through DME directly (866-599-0951).

IMPORTANT: If you do make an advance reservation for the way home, you will be sent an entire DME packet. In that packet will be those yellow DME luggage tags. THROW THEM OUT. They are unnecessary for you. Those tags are used ONLY for your arrival in Orlando, and are totlaly meaningless for the trip from resort back to airport, which will be the only leg of DME you'll be taking. Those tags will be sent because any DME reservation triggers the entire DME packet to be sent, even though you will have no use for those luggage tags.
